Kurdish-led Forces, Syrian Government Ink New Ceasefire Stabilization Deal
- •The Syrian Democratic Forces (SDF) and the Syrian government have reached a new agreement to stabilize a ceasefire and integrate forces.
- •Security forces from the Syrian Ministry of Interior will enter al-Hassakeh and Qamishli, previously restricted areas.
- •The agreement includes forming new military brigades by integrating SDF and government forces, including one in Aleppo province.
- •Local institutions and employees in northeast Syria's Kurdish-led government will be integrated into state institutions.
- •The deal guarantees civil and educational rights for the Kurdish people, including Kurdish as a national language, and the return of displaced persons.
Why It Matters: SDF and Syrian government agree to stabilize ceasefire, integrate forces, and grant Kurdish rights.
